Fix KISS over WIFI
parent
95e4d81247
commit
3605bffe64
|
@ -32,7 +32,7 @@ void handleKISSData(char character, int bufferIndex) {
|
||||||
return;
|
return;
|
||||||
}
|
}
|
||||||
inTNCData->concat(character);
|
inTNCData->concat(character);
|
||||||
if (character == (char) FEND && (char) U_SABME && inTNCData->length() > 3) {
|
if (character == (char) U_SABME && inTNCData->length() > 3) {
|
||||||
bool isDataFrame = false;
|
bool isDataFrame = false;
|
||||||
const String &TNC2DataFrame = decode_kiss_pkt(*inTNCData, isDataFrame);
|
const String &TNC2DataFrame = decode_kiss_pkt(*inTNCData, isDataFrame);
|
||||||
|
|
||||||
|
@ -90,7 +90,7 @@ void handleKISSData(char character, int bufferIndex) {
|
||||||
iterateWifiClients([](WiFiClient * client, int clientIdx, const String * unused){
|
iterateWifiClients([](WiFiClient * client, int clientIdx, const String * unused){
|
||||||
while (client->available() > 0) {
|
while (client->available() > 0) {
|
||||||
char character = client->read();
|
char character = client->read();
|
||||||
handleKISSData(character, 2+clientIdx);
|
handleKISSData(character, 1);
|
||||||
}
|
}
|
||||||
}, nullptr, clients, MAX_WIFI_CLIENTS);
|
}, nullptr, clients, MAX_WIFI_CLIENTS);
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ue